Righto, my cat-back is shot. It's being held on the cat with a clothes hanger, there's as much air blowing out the front of the muffler as the back, and the axle rubs the pipe every time my shocks depress.

I'm sounding like a bloody ricer, and I'm not getting near the milage I should be getting. (25 highway, rather than 33 before my exhaust went bad).

I remember someone in here saying that for a good power mod they swapped in a v6 muffler, so I was wondering if that was a direct swap, or any mods necessary, and could I go a step further and pull a full cat-back from a junkyard?

And as I usually do, I rambled a bit, sorry bout that.

But basically, would I be able to pull a cat back from a 94+ mustang in a junkyard, and have it bolt right onto my car, clear the axle and everything?

The deal with that is that it will physically fit, however the hangers will be different from the style that is on your car now (probably) and the flange at the front might be positioned differently from yours.

The 94+ cars are longer...it's not gonna happen without major modification...tails will be too long, midpipe will be too long and not line up to stock location.
